Not all solar propositions are produced equal
One of the simplest blunders to make is contrasting proposals just by overall rate or by cost per watt. Those numbers issue, but they are only component of the story. Two systems with the exact same price can vary significantly in result, devices quality, warranty assistance, and long-lasting value.
I have actually seen house owners obtain one proposition for a 7 kW system and one more for an 8.2 kW system, then concentrate on the fact that the larger one sets you back numerous thousand dollars more. That comparison is insufficient. A far better concern is how much yearly manufacturing each system is anticipated to provide under genuine website problems, exactly how the installer modeled shading, whether the inverter choice fits the roof design, and whether there are covert financing costs pushing up the effective price.
A lower-priced bid can end up being the more pricey option if the system is undersized, mounted with weaker solution assistance, or tied to funding terms that quietly add tens of thousands in time. By comparison, a slightly greater quote from among the stronger solar providers might be justified if the layout is much more thoughtful, the workmanship is much better, and the firm has a trustworthy service department.

Pricing in Yard Valley, and why affordable can get expensive
Solar rates in The golden state has actually moved around throughout the years, so it is better to believe in arrays than set numbers. For a regular domestic system in Lawn Valley, costs can differ significantly based on roofing system complexity, tools choices, electric work, and whether a battery is consisted of. A simple panel-only installation on a newer make-up tile roof may be far less expensive than a task on an older roofing with circuit box upgrades and storage.
The financing structure can change the business economics as high as the equipment. Money purchases usually give the clearest long-term value due to the fact that there are no lender fees folded right into the system cost. Finances can still make sense, particularly for home owners who wish to protect liquidity, but the terms should have very close attention. Low promoted rate of interest often feature large supplier costs that are buried in the principal. That implies the month-to-month settlement can look eye-catching while the overall system cost climbs up sharply.
Leases and power acquisition contracts are not automatically bad, however they are entitled to caution. They can help some families that focus on reduced ahead of time price and do not want possession obligations. Still, they frequently complicate home sales, reduce flexibility for future upgrades, and restrict the direct monetary benefit that comes from possessing the system. In a location where several homeowners believe long-term concerning home worth and independence, possession typically straightens much better with the local mindset.
Batteries belong to the conversation now
For years, solar discussions focused virtually totally on countering electric expenses. Now batteries play a much larger function, specifically in neighborhoods where interruptions are a genuine problem. In Grass Valley, this is not an abstract issue. Public safety and security power shutoffs, storm-related disturbances, and general grid integrity worries have made backup power a functional topic for families, not a deluxe add-on.
That does not indicate every home requires a battery. Some families are primarily trying to reduce utility costs and may determine that solar alone is the far better initial step. Others want to maintain refrigeration, internet, medical tools, well pumps, or a few important circuits running during interruptions. The appropriate service provider will assist specify what resilience implies in your house instead of merely connecting a battery to every quote.
Battery sizing is another location where straightforward advice issues. A solitary battery can sustain chosen tons for a significant duration, yet it will not always run a whole home with central air, electrical food preparation, and every comfort switched on. Homeowners are much better offered by a reasonable tons analysis than by broad pledges. The far better solar business will certainly go through those assumptions in ordinary language.
Roof problem, tree cover, and the truths of rural properties
Some of the hardest discussions in household solar have absolutely nothing to do with panel brand names. They have to do with the roofing system, the trees, and the site itself. Lawn Valley has plenty of properties with beautiful fully grown landscape design, which elegance can make complex solar design. Shade from one big pine can materially impact output on component of an array. Module-level electronics like microinverters or optimizers can help in reducing losses from unequal manufacturing, but they are not magic. If large areas of the roof covering are deeply shaded for long components of the day, the economics may weaken.
Roof age is similarly essential. Mounting solar on a roof covering that may need substitute in a few years is commonly an inadequate choice unless the reroof is resolved initially. Eliminating and re-installing panels later on adds price and hassle. A trustworthy installer will not play down that indicate keep a sale alive.
Rural and semi-rural homes include a few even more variables. Long conduit runs, trenching demands, detached garages, and well pump backup requirements can all form the system layout. A company that often manages these circumstances will generally bring an extra useful, much less academic technique to the estimate.

How much is a solar system for a 2000 sq ft house in Grass Valley?
A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$12,000 to $25,000 before applicable incentives, depending on the required capacity. Square footage alone does not determine system size because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, equipment selection, electrical upgrades, and battery storage can substantially affect the price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.

Why is my electric bill high if I have solar in Grass Valley?
An electric bill can remain high when household electricity consumption exceeds the amount generated by the solar system. Nighttime usage, heating or cooling, seasonal production changes, shading, or equipment problems can increase electricity purchased from the grid. Fixed utility charges may also remain even when solar offsets much of a home's electricity use. Comparing solar production with utility consumption can help identify the cause.
